What Is The Estimated Market Size Of The Neuroprosthetics Market During 2026–2030?
The neuroprosthetics market has experienced substantial growth in recent years. This market is projected to expand from $11.63 billion in 2025 to $13.39 billion by 2026, exhibiting a compound annual growth rate (CAGR) of 15.1%. Historically, this expansion can be attributed to factors such as the early creation of functional electrical stimulation systems, augmented research into brain-machine interfaces, an increase in the prevalence of motor neuron disorders, advancements in cochlear implant technologies, and the initial implementation of deep brain stimulation.
The neuroprosthetics market is poised for significant expansion in the coming years. This market is projected to reach $23.1 billion by 2030, exhibiting a compound annual growth rate (CAGR) of 14.6%. This projected growth stems from several factors, including the increasing demand for sophisticated prosthetic limbs with neural control, heightened investment in cognitive neuroprosthetics, the broader application of vagus nerve stimulation, a surge in the adoption of retinal implant innovations, and the ongoing development of advanced exoskeletons for rehabilitation purposes. Key trends anticipated during this period encompass the growing uptake of motor neuroprosthetic systems, wider utilization of auditory neuroprosthetics for restoring hearing, progress in retinal and visual prosthetic technologies, greater incorporation of cognitive neuroprosthetics into therapeutic practices, and the extended use of neurostimulation techniques to aid functional recovery.

Which Economic Or Industry Drivers Are Impacting The Neuroprosthetics Market?
The increasing incidence of hearing loss is anticipated to drive the expansion of the neuroprosthetics market in the coming years. Hearing loss, also recognized as hearing impairment or deafness, describes a partial or total inability to perceive sounds in one or both ears, significantly impacting communication, overall quality of life, and social engagement. Neuroprosthetic solutions, including cochlear implants and auditory prostheses, are instrumental in restoring hearing, improving speech comprehension, and facilitating auditory rehabilitation. For instance, in February 2025, the World Health Organization (WHO) projected that by 2050, nearly 2.5 billion people globally will experience some level of hearing loss, with over 700 million expected to need hearing rehabilitation. Additionally, unaddressed hearing impairment already leads to nearly US$1 trillion in annual costs, and 1 billion young adults are at risk of preventable, permanent damage due to unsafe listening practices. Therefore, the growing prevalence of hearing loss is a primary factor boosting the neuroprosthetics market.
How Are The Various Segments Of The Neuroprosthetics Market Categorized?
The neuroprosthetics market covered in this report is segmented –
1) By Type: Motor Neuroprosthetics, Auditory Neuroprosthetics Or Cochlear implants, Visual Neuroprosthetics Or Retinal implants, Cognitive Neuroprosthetics
2) By Technique: Spinal Cord Stimulation, Deep Brain Stimulation, Vagus Nerve Stimulation, Sacral Nerve Stimulation, Transcranial Magnetic Stimulation
3) By Application: Motor Neuron Disorders, Physiological Disorders, Cognitive Disorders
Subsegments:
1) By Motor Neuroprosthetics: Functional Electrical Stimulation (FES) Systems, Brain-Machine Interfaces (BMIs), Prosthetic Limbs With Neural Control, Exoskeletons For Rehabilitation
2) By Auditory Neuroprosthetics Or Cochlear Implants: Cochlear Implants (Single and Multi-Channel), Auditory Brainstem Implants (ABI), Bone-Anchored Hearing Aids (BAHA)
3) By Visual Neuroprosthetics Or Retinal Implants: Retinal Prostheses, Optogenetic Implants, Visual Cortical Implants
4) By Cognitive Neuroprosthetics: Deep Brain Stimulation (DBS) Devices, Cognitive Enhancement Implants, Neurostimulation Devices For Cognitive Disorders
How Are Trends Shaping The Direction Of The Neuroprosthetics Market?
Major companies operating in the neuroprosthetics market are focusing on developing innovative advancements such as sEEG electrode systems to improve neural interfacing capabilities and enhance minimally invasive diagnostic and therapeutic procedures. An sEEG electrode system is a specialized neural device designed to record and stimulate subsurface brain activity, enabling high-precision mapping and neuromodulation. For instance, in May 2023, NeuroOne Medical Technologies Corporation, a US-based medical technology company, launched the Evo sEEG Electrodes in the United States. NeuroOne’s new electrodes deliver secure, high-accuracy subsurface brain mapping with improved signal clarity and compatibility with robotic neurosurgical platforms. This innovation broadens the clinical utility of stereoelectroencephalography by enabling less invasive procedures and supporting expansion into applications such as epilepsy evaluation, chronic pain management, and Parkinson’s disease interventions.

What Are The Top-Performing Regions Within The Neuroprosthetics Market?
North America was the largest region in the neuroprosthetics market in 2025. Asia-Pacific is expected to be the fastest-growing region in the forecast period.
